Transform Privacy and Comfort with Home Window Tint
Window tint has become the most popular choice for homeowners looking to enhance the privacy and comfort of their living spaces. By blocking harmful UV rays and unwanted sunlight, window tint can help to create a cozier environment inside your home.
Furthermore, it offers greater privacy by making it difficult for people outside to see what's happening inside. This can be especially beneficial for ground floor windows, bedrooms, and bathrooms. Putting in window tint is a relatively simple process that can significantly improve your home's look.
